Rhabdoweisia fugax is a small moss species belonging to the Dicranaceae family. It is strictly a wild botanical species and is not considered a cultivated agricultural crop in any agronomic context.

This moss is typically found in humid, shaded environments, specifically growing on acidic rocks and in crevices. It thrives in regions with high atmospheric moisture and cool climates.

Botanically, it forms dense, soft mats. The leaves are narrow and lanceolate, adapted to minimize water loss while maximizing the surface area for absorption from the humid air.

The environmental requirements include a stable, sheltered microclimate. It is highly sensitive to desiccation, requiring constant high humidity to prevent the tissues from drying out and dying.

In terms of agricultural or economic utility, Rhabdoweisia fugax is not used commercially. Its primary value is ecological, acting as a pioneer species in colonizing bare rock surfaces in forest ecosystems.

Main diseases and pests

The main threats to Rhabdoweisia fugax include habitat destruction due to deforestation, which alters the light and moisture levels necessary for its survival.

Air pollution, particularly sulfur dioxide and other industrial emissions, significantly inhibits its growth and reproductive capabilities as it relies on air moisture.

Climate change poses a severe risk, as shifting weather patterns can lead to prolonged dry spells that are lethal to this species of moss.

Erosion and physical disruption of rocky slopes, whether from natural causes or human activity, can lead to the loss of established moss colonies.

Encroachment of invasive plant species that are better suited to changing microclimatic conditions can outcompete and displace these slow-growing moss mats.
